Rudolph Fisher, a 35-year-old African American physician and writer, released The Conjure-Man Dies: A Harlem Mystery in 1932, making it the first known crime fiction by a Black American. Fisher died only two years later, while he was still tragically young, so we'll never know what further works would have cemented Fisher's place among golden era mystery authors.

This groundbreaking work of fiction, on its own, is significant for its representation of Harlem's African American society and culture in the 1930s. Its protagonists are all Black, including its crime-solving police detective, Perry Dart, and his forensics specialist medical sidekick, John Archer.

The story is marked by a number of unexpected turns, notably one halfway through when, after African psychic and "conjure-man" N'Gana Frimbo has been murdered and delivered to the medical examiner, his body disappears, throwing into question the entire nature of the crime they've been investigating.

What does Emerson say about consistency in Self-reliance?

According to Emerson, a foolish consistency is the hobgoblin of little minds, adored by little statesmen and philosophers, and divines. With consistency, a great soul has simply nothing to do. He may as well concern himself with his shadow on the wall.
